Linda, you are going to have to start doing what I do. That's start a Christmas Club account at your bank. Most accept $5, $10, $15, $20, and more a week.
Rick and I put in $20 each a week, so you figure how much we have for Christmas. We do put some toward house insurance....it always comes due around then too. Then they just mail you the check with interest for Christmas. I just rec'd mine yesterday. If I didn't do this, there would be no money for Christmas here either.
